[0001] This invention belongs to the field of ultra-high vacuum, specifically a novel structure of a composite ion pump. Background Technology
[0002] In recent years, composite ion pumps have been widely developed as an important means of achieving ultra-high vacuum. NEG pumps (non-evaporative getter pumps), as a type of non-evaporative adsorption vacuum pump, do not evaporate additional gases during operation, unlike titanium sublimators. Instead, they utilize the chemical reactivity of the material itself to achieve degassing through surface adsorption or further internal diffusion. NEG pumps are small in size and compact in structure, and can operate without a power source after activation. Combining NEG pumps with ion pumps not only compensates for the significant drop in pumping speed of ion pumps at low pressures, but also allows NEG pumps to maintain extremely high pumping speeds for air, water vapor, and hydrogen, which is beneficial for achieving higher ultimate vacuums.
[0003] The composite structure of NEG pump and ion pump is relatively easy to implement in high-pumping-speed ion pumps. However, in low-pumping-speed ion pumps, due to the small volume and compact structure, it is necessary to take into account both the pump inlet position and the NEG electrode position. Therefore, the design of the composite pump structure of NEG pump and ion pump must take into account the above factors. Summary of the Invention

Detailed Implementation
[0016] The invention will now be described in further detail with reference to the accompanying drawings.
[0017] like Figure 1As shown, the present invention includes an NEG pump, an adapter tube 9, a flange-connector weldment, and an ion pump 13. One end of the flange-connector weldment is connected to the pump port of the ion pump 13, and the other end of the flange-connector weldment is connected to the pump core 7 of the NEG pump via the adapter tube 9. The flange-connector weldment includes a flange 10, a connector 11, and an NEG electrode plug 12. One end of the connector 11 is connected to the pump port of the ion pump 13, the flange 10 is connected to the other end of the connector 11, the NEG electrode plug 12 is connected to the connector 11, and one end of the adapter tube 9 is connected to the pump core 7. The other end of the adapter tube 9 is mounted on the flange 10. The adapter tube 9 has an opening 15 for air intake. The adapter tube 9, flange 10 and pipe 11 are connected in sequence. The NEG electrode plug 12 is connected to one end of the lead wire A5 through the connecting terminal 6. The other end of the lead wire A5 is connected to one end of the connecting post 2 after passing through the insulating ceramic tube 4. The other end of the connecting post 2 is connected to the lead wire B on the pump core 7. The connecting post 2, insulating ceramic tube 4, lead wire A5 and connecting terminal 6 are all located inside the adapter tube 9, flange 10 and pipe 11 that are connected.
[0018] In this embodiment, the ion pump 13 is a 20L ion pump manufactured by SKY Corporation (Shenyang Scientific Instruments Co., Ltd., Chinese Academy of Sciences), with the pump inlet replaced by a flange-connected welded part.
[0019] The pump core 7 of the NEG pump in this embodiment is a Saes D400 pump core (SES Getter (Nanjing) Co., Ltd.).
[0020] In this embodiment, one end of the adapter tube 9 is annular, and the pump core 7 is inserted into the annular ring and fixed to the adapter tube 9 by the side set screw 8. The left and right sides of the axial section of the adapter tube 9 are symmetrically provided with openings 15 along the length direction. The bottom of the outer side of the annular ring is chamfered 14. Through the openings 15 and chamfers 14 on both sides of the adapter tube 9, it is ensured that the gas can smoothly enter the ion pump 13 through the openings 15 on both sides and be pumped away by the ion pump 13. It also greatly increases the gas intake of the ion pump 13, thus realizing the NEG pump activation and the gas entering the ion pump 13 to achieve the gas pumping function.
[0021] In this embodiment, one end of the connector 11 is argon-arc welded to the pump port of the ion pump 13, with a leakage rate of less than 1×10E-10 Pa·L / S. The NEG electrode plug 12 is argon-arc welded to the side of the connector 11, that is, the axial center line of the NEG electrode plug 12 intersects the axial center line of the connector 11 perpendicularly. The flange 10 is argon-arc welded to the other end of the connector 11. The flange 10 is provided with two connecting lugs, and the lower end of the adapter cylinder 9 is provided with two extensions, which are respectively fixed to the two connecting lugs on the flange 10 by screws 3.
[0022] In this embodiment, the NEG electrode plug 12 is a two-core NEG electrode plug. The two-core NEG electrode plug is crimped together with two leads A5 through the connecting terminal 6. The insulating ceramic tube 4 passes through the two leads A5 and serves to insulate the two leads A5. The leads A5 are fixed to the connecting post 2 by countersunk screws 1.
